Manchmal laesst sich hiermit der alte Zustand ansehen, aber nur, wenn nicht andere Anwendungen (flash) benutzt wurden:
http://web.archive.org
The wayback machine...
Beispielsweise ist die Seite ueber Paul Mages irgendwann nicht mehr on line gewesen. Aber es gibt sie noch, ueberwiegend....
http://web.archive.org/web/200412151235 ... paulmages/
(Danke an SM-Carsten fuer den genialen Tip mit der wayback machine).
Buecher zuverlaessig sichern?
Open Library
http://openlibrary.org/
Quote:
"One web page for every book ever published.
Over 20 million books already have a page on OpenLibrary.org, and over 1 million of those give you access to a full-text, downloadable version.
Please participate in the building of this site. It is an Open project - the software is open, the data is open, the documentation is open, and the site is open. Anyone can participate in this project, whether you're a librarian who wants to add records of digitized books to her local catalog, or you're a lover of books who wants to make sure his favorites are well represented, or you just want to find a good book to read for free, or you're a programmer who wants to build something new on top of this data."
